Shares of Lenovo Group surged more than 15% on Friday following the release of its latest quarterly results. The company reported group revenue of $21.6 billion for the March quarter, a 27% year-on-year increase, as artificial intelligence-related revenue nearly doubled, reaching over a third of total revenue.

The personal computer and electronics giant posted a strong performance for the quarter ended March 31. Group revenue reached $21.6 billion, up 27% year-on-year—the highest growth rate in five years for the Hong Kong–based multinational company. Net income rose by nearly a factor of six to $521 million. Full-year results also reached a record level. The standout performer was Lenovo’s AI-related revenue, which surged 84% in the fourth quarter. This category includes devices such as PCs and smartphones with neural processing units, servers with graphics processing units, and related services. AI-related revenue now accounts for more than a third of total group revenue. Chairman and CEO Yuanqing Yang stated that the company aims to become a $100 billion enterprise within the next two years, with much of the growth strategy hinging on its artificial intelligence initiatives. Lenovo’s current market capitalization is approximately $24 billion.

Lenovo’s latest financial results highlight the potential for traditional hardware manufacturers to benefit from the expanding artificial intelligence ecosystem. The rapid growth of AI-related revenue suggests that the company may be effectively capitalizing on the shift toward AI-capable devices and infrastructure. From a market perspective, Lenovo’s performance could be seen as a positive indicator for the broader PC and server industry, as AI integration becomes a key differentiator. However, the ambitious $100 billion revenue target would likely require not only organic growth but also potential acquisitions or new business lines. Investors may want to monitor the pace of AI adoption across Lenovo’s product portfolio and the competitive landscape from rivals such as Dell and HP. While the recent earnings report is encouraging, the company’s ability to sustain such high growth rates remains uncertain, given macroeconomic headwinds and cyclical demand in the PC market.
